FPS 3000 Troubleshooting Simulator Released - June 15th 2008

Troubleshoot an Industrial Control System with the FPS 3000 Troubleshooting Simulator.

This simulation models a fluid processing system similar to systems found in various industrial applications. This system consists of a variety of components including a Pump, Agitator, Heaters, Motors, Transformers, Contactors, and Overloads.

The control portion of the system consists of a variety of components typically found in industrial control systems such as: Temperature, Float, & Selector Switches, Relays, Timers, Pushbuttons, Solenoid Valves, Fuses, and Indicators.

New Features Added to Troubleshooting Skills Series - January 2005

Single user version of all programs now allow you to retry faults. Once you have completed all the faults in any one of the programs (BT has 16 faults, BCC has 28, and MCC has 24) you will be able to retry these faults over and over again!
